
在数字化时代,拥有一个网站已经成为企业和个人展示自己、推广品牌和产品的重要工具,Java作为一门强大的编程语言,其开发网站的能力不容小觑,本文将为您介绍如何利用Java进行网站开发,从基础搭建到上线流程,再到回滚预案的制定,帮助您轻松掌握网站建设的核心技能。
Java 建站基础知识
Java 语言简介
Java是一种广泛使用的面向对象编程语言,以其“一次编写,到处运行”的特性而闻名,它不仅支持多种平台,还具有跨平台的优势,使得开发者能够构建可移植、高效的应用程序。
网站开发框架选择
选择合适的网站开发框架对于快速搭建网站至关重要,常见的Java网站开发框架有Spring Boot、SSM(Spring + Spring MVC + MyBatis)等,这些框架提供了丰富的功能和便捷的开发体验,可以大大加快开发速度。
数据库选择与设计
网站的后端数据存储是核心部分,Java常用的数据库有MySQL、Oracle等,选择合适的数据库并设计合理的数据库结构,是确保网站稳定运行的关键。
从0到上线的建站流程
需求分析与规划
在开始编程之前,首先需要明确网站的目标用户、功能需求以及预期效果,这有助于后续的设计和开发工作更加有的放矢。
前端设计与实现
网站的前端设计是吸引用户的重要因素之一,使用HTML、CSS和JavaScript等技术,结合响应式设计,可以制作出既美观又易于操作的网站界面。
后端开发与集成
后端开发是整个网站的核心,通过Java语言,可以实现数据处理、业务逻辑处理等功能,与前端的交互也需要后端的支持,如API接口的调用等。
测试与部署
在网站开发完成后,需要进行详细的测试以确保没有漏洞和错误,测试包括功能测试、性能测试、安全测试等多个方面,测试通过后,就可以将网站部署到服务器上,供用户访问了。
回滚预案的制定
备份策略
在上线前,应制定完善的备份策略,包括代码备份、数据库备份等,这样在遇到意外情况时,可以迅速恢复网站状态,减少损失。
故障处理流程
制定清晰的故障处理流程,一旦发生问题,可以迅速定位原因并采取相应措施,这包括日志记录、问题上报、临时解决方案等。
灾难恢复计划
对于可能出现的灾难性事件,如硬件故障、网络攻击等,应有相应的应对措施,这可能包括异地备份、数据迁移等。
Java建站是一个系统工程,涉及多个环节,从基础搭建到上线流程,再到回滚预案的制定,每一步都需要精心策划和执行,只有充分准备,才能确保网站的成功上线和稳定运行。

总浏览